For a great time we would like to suggest the following itinerary:
DAY 1:
Tour the Colony of Avalon’s archaeological dig in Ferryland with a picnic lunch at the old lighthouse. Dinner theatre is available on selected evenings.
DAY 2:
A hiking trip to the former settlement of LaManche. The river just before the suspension bridge is a nice swimming area.
DAY 3:
A boat tour of the Witless Bay Ecological Reserve and/or a kayaking trip out of Cape Broyle (Stan Cook)or Bay Bulls.
DAY 4:
A hike along the East Coast Trail system- for a short hike we recommend the Beaches and Mickeleen trails that are situated here in Witless Bay- for a longer hike (day trip) we recommend ‘the spout’ trip north of Bay Bulls.
DAY 5:
St. John’s, which takes more than 1 day depending on your interests.
DAY 6:
Salmonier Nature Park on the way to Cape St. Mary’s, a ‘must-see’ while you’re in the area.
If you like an old-fashioned picnic within walking distance, the picnic area by the Lower Pond (which fronts the Atlantic) is ideal.
